Sheet Pan Omelet

A sheet pan omelet is a time-saver that yields multiple servings in one bake. Loaded with eggs and your favorite toppings, it produces fluffy slices that store and travel well—perfect for grab-and-go mornings or feeding a crowd. Preparing a full pan ahead of time simplifies busy mornings and ensures a protein-forward start that helps you stay focused and energized.
Cream Cheese Pancakes

Cream cheese pancakes combine eggs and cream cheese for a higher-protein twist on a classic breakfast. Their thin, delicate texture makes them light yet satisfying, helping you avoid the midmorning slump. Top with fresh berries or a small drizzle of syrup for a quick, tasty meal that keeps your energy steady on busy mornings.
Breakfast Casserole

A breakfast casserole layers eggs, sausage, and cheese into a hearty, make-ahead meal. It bakes up into satisfying portions that reheat well and hold up through the week. This option is excellent when you want a filling breakfast that supports a packed schedule without extra morning prep.

Egg Muffins

Egg muffins are versatile, portable, and easy to customize. Made with a base of beaten eggs and mix-ins like vegetables, cheese, or meat, they bake quickly and store well. Grab a couple on your way out the door for a satisfying, protein-rich start that keeps you energized for meetings, errands, or workouts.
Protein Pudding

Protein pudding is a creamy, simple option that doubles as a treat and a substantial breakfast. With protein powder, milk or alternative, and optional add-ins like nut butter or berries, it’s easy to prepare and can be made ahead. The smooth texture feels indulgent while delivering the nutrients needed to sustain your energy through a busy morning.

2-Ingredient English Muffins

Two-ingredient English muffins use just eggs and cheese to create a warm, wholesome base for toppings like cream cheese, avocado, or smoked salmon. They’re quick to prepare and offer a comforting texture while delivering the protein needed for a productive morning.
Baked Scotch Eggs

Baked Scotch eggs pair seasoned sausage with a hard-cooked egg for a portable, protein-rich option that travels well. Their crisp exterior and tender interior make them satisfying for breakfast or lunch on the go. They’re hearty enough to keep you focused and energized whether you’re at home or on the move.
